Eva Mendes did Christmas in style.
Sharing two selfies after the holiday, she “survived being Santa Mama,” adding, “I was hurting all of Xmas day – but I did it!”
The mom of two with partner Ryan Gosling knows that the struggle is real during the holidays.
Wearing red tartan plaid pajamas, a lit-up tree blurry in the background, Mendes’ updo is slightly disheveled and her eye makeup delivering next-day smokey vibes.
“I actually do my eye makeup on Christmas Eve since I know I will barely sleep that night so at least I wake up with some eyes,” the actress jokingly wrote in her Instagram caption.
“Happy holidays to all those that – no matter what the obstacle – make X mas magical for the kids,” she added.
Though the beauty hack was meant as a joke, the sentiment was real, sending her fans into a flurry and filling her comments with words of support.
“You don’t have any idea what this post means to me,” wrote one. “Mommas are truly superheroes. Cheers to us!” wrote another. “This is real strength and real beauty,” one fan added.
A few days prior, Mendes and Gosling were spotted out on a rare outing with their children. The family is typically quite private when it comes to public appearances and social media shares.
E! News reported that the actress explained, “I have always had a clear boundary when it comes to my man and my kids. I’ll talk about them, of course, with limits, but I won’t post pictures of our daily life.”
She continued, “Since my children are still so little and don’t understand what posting their image really means, I don’t have their consent. And I won’t post their image until they’re old enough to give me consent.”
On December 15, Mendes spoke about “creating a full-on experience” for her kids on Christmas, sharing stories of growing up and celebrating with her family.
“We didn’t have much,” she wrote, “But my Mami always managed to make Christmas so special. I remember she’d go into debt after every Christmas, but somehow she managed to make it happen again the next year.”
